This is a three-drug combination regimen under clinical investigation for the treatment of advanced or metastatic hepatocellular carcinoma. - **ERY974** is a bispecific monoclonal antibody that targets glypican-3 (GPC3) on tumor cells and CD3 on T cells, acting as a T-cell engager to redirect T-cell cytotoxicity towards GPC3-expressing cancer cells. - **Atezolizumab** is a monoclonal antibody immune checkpoint inhibitor targeting programmed death-ligand 1 (PD-L1), blocking its interaction with PD-1 and B7.1 receptors to enable immune-mediated tumor cell destruction. - **Bevacizumab** is a monoclonal antibody targeting vascular endothelial growth factor A (VEGF-A), inhibiting angiogenesis within tumors. The combination is evaluated for enhanced anti-tumor efficacy and manageable safety in patients with locally advanced/metastatic hepatocellular carcinoma; it is currently in early phase clinical studies[3]. ERY974 is developed by Chugai (a member of the Roche Group); atezolizumab and bevacizumab are developed by Roche/Genentech.
